Owens State Community College Industrial Production Technology Associate’s Program

The industrial production tech program at Owens State Community College awarded 7 associate's degrees in 2020-2021. About 86% of these degrees went to men with the other 14% going to women.

undefined

The majority of the students with this major are white. About 71% of 2021 graduates were in this category.
